Paul Pelosi, the husband of House Speaker Nancy Pelosi, has been attacked by an intruder in a targeted attack on the couple’s San Francisco home.

The intruder, identified as 42-year-old David Depape shouted “Where is Nancy” repeatedly before confronting Paul. Chief of police, William Scott, said that when police went to the Pelosi household for a well-being check, officers found Depape and Paul struggling over a hammer until Depape was able to get the hammer away from Pelosi and violently assault him. Upon this, Depape was taken into custody and has been charged with attempted homicide, assault with a deadly weapon, elder abuse, burglary and several other additional felonies.

Paul Pelosi is currently at a local hospital and is expected to make a full recovery.
